Ready Mix Driver
Operates ready mix trucks in a safe and professional manner in the plant yard, on public highways/roads, and at various job sites to deliver products. Deliveries will be made in both commercial and residential areas.
Key Responsibilities:
- Maintains equipment in a safe and clean condition.
- Performs pre and post-trip truck inspections.
- Verify general compliance with mix specifications after loading and at job site.
- Aligns mixer drum under disbursement chute at the plant to receive product into the mixer truck drum.
- Drives ready mix truck to location for unloading.
- Operate ready mix truck to release concrete down truck chute into area to be poured with concrete.
- Cleans truck after delivery to prevent concrete from hardening in mixer and on truck.
- Places and operates chutes to deliver product where directed.

Physical Requirements:
- GRIP - with at least 75 lbs. of force
- CLIMBING - in, around, and on equipment
- HEAVY LIFTING - of extremely awkward parts and equipment up to 50 lbs. from floor to waist
- CARRYING - awkward parts and equipment up to 50 lbs. for 50 feet or more
- HIGH LIFT - of up to 50 lbs. floor to shoulder
- AWKWARD LIFT - of up to 35 lbs. shoulder to away from body
- FLEXIBILITY- awkward reaches
- BALANCE – including standing and walking on extremely slick and uneven surfaces while carrying.
- VISION- 20/40 corrected vision to see moving safety hazards, moving equipment, vehicles, and obstructions
- HEARING – corrected to hear verbal safety warnings and instructions from coworkers
Work Environment:
- Occasionally exposed to wet and/or humid conditions; moving mechanical parts; outside weather conditions; and extreme cold and/or heat.
- The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
